First and foremost, practice makes perfect. The more you speak, the better you'll become. Try to find opportunities to practice your English every day, whether it's through conversations with native speakers, language exchange partners, or even by talking to yourself in English. Remember, even a few minutes of practice can make a big difference.
Another key to improving your speaking skills is to expand your vocabulary. A rich vocabulary allows you to express your thoughts more clearly and effectively. Try to learn new words every day, and make sure you understand their meanings and usage. Additionally, pay attention to collocations, which are words that often go together in English. This will help you sound more natural and fluent.
Listening to native speakers is another great way to improve your speaking skills. By listening to how they speak, you can learn about pronunciation, intonation, and rhythm. Try to listen to a variety of English speakers, such as news anchors, podcasters, and YouTube influencers. This will help you get used to different accents and styles of speaking.
One of the most effective ways to improve your speaking is to engage in speaking activities. This could include joining a conversation group, participating in a debate, or even giving a presentation. These activities will help you practice your speaking skills in a real-life context and give you the opportunity to receive feedback from others. Don't be afraid to make mistakes; they're a natural part of the learning process.
Another important aspect of speaking is pronunciation. While it's important to focus on your grammar and vocabulary, your pronunciation can greatly impact how well you're understood. Work on your mouth positions, tongue placement, and articulation. You can also use online resources, such as language learning apps and pronunciation guides, to help you improve.
Building confidence is crucial when it comes to speaking English. One way to do this is by setting achievable goals for yourself. Start with small, manageable goals, such as speaking for one minute without hesitation or participating in a conversation with a native speaker. As you achieve these goals, you'll feel more confident and motivated to continue improving.
Remember that everyone has their own pace when learning a language. Don't compare yourself to others or get discouraged if you're not progressing as quickly as you'd like. Celebrate your small victories and be patient with yourself. With time and dedication, you'll see significant improvements in your speaking skills.
